Runbook: Lanternkit component library versioning

Hey plugin folks — quick refresher. Lanternkit follows strict semver, and your plugin manifest must pin a major version; minor bumps ship weekly, so don't pin those unless you enjoy churn. Breaking changes land behind a feature flag for one release cycle first, announced in the Toadvine release notes. If your plugin breaks after an upgrade, check the compat matrix before filing anything. To build against the registry, your local toolchain needs the settings shown directly below.

deployment values, kajep-kageg:
[praix]
host = praix.paliqcorp.corp
user = praix_svc
database = praix_prod

Ticket: Fieldpace timing-chip reader drops reads at mat 3 when runner density exceeds ~40/sec. Firmware buffer overflows silently; no error raised. Affects the Harrowgate Marathon build only. Patch widens the buffer and adds overflow logging. Needed before Sunday's race. Release manager: hold the rollout until QA signs off on the patched firmware, identified by the token below.

pipeline stamp: htk31_f769b577b3028a4e9958e5bb8d1259a

## Step 4: Update your receipt hooks

Plugin folks: Givlet 5 moves the donation-receipt mailer onto the new Postwren pipeline, so your old `on_receipt` hooks won't fire anymore. Swap them for `receipt.rendered` listeners and drop any direct template overrides — those are config-driven now. Test against the Hollowmere sandbox before shipping. The sandbox mailer runs with the settings shown below.

deployment values, faduf-tawep:
SORDOR_LOG_LEVEL=error
SORDOR_METRICS_HOST=metrics.sordor.nelvrolabs.internal
SORDOR_POOL_SIZE=4

Ticket: Staging env misconfigured for Siftgate bloom filter

The bloom layer in front of the Pellet KV store is rejecting all lookups in staging because the env file was copied from the dev template without credentials. False-positive tuning values are fine; only the auth line is missing. To unblock the weekly demo, the Pellet admission secret must be set on the following line.

env line for yaguf-fajop: LEDGER_TOKEN13=fb08984397349